Kecently Mr J. Payton coioutt resigned bis seat on the! oxuk llasterton Park Trust, moke, and the Trustees recommended tlio Government toappointMrA, li.D'Aroy as liissucccssor. Tbe Government has rejected this recommendation, and Ims appointed Mr W. 0. Oargill. We expect Mr Cnrgill to bo a useful and capable Trustee, and have no objection nt nil to'his occupation of the vacant scat. Unl why should Mr A D'Accy have been rejected ? We did not know till now that he was the " wrong color," but evidently he is or his name would not have been challenged. The incident shows tbe pitiful and petty feeling that animates the present administration.
